0.0.6-2 • Published 2 years ago

@talo-code/talo-converter-openapi3-swagger2 v0.0.6-2

Weekly downloads
-
License
MIT
Repository
-
Last release
2 years ago

Convertir OpenAPI 3 a Swagger 2

Instalación

Para instalar el paquete, ejecute el siguiente comando:

npm i @talo-code/talo-converter-openapi3-swagger2

Para probar el paquete desde el lugar donde se instaló, agregue el siguiente script al archivo package.jsonde su proyecto:

json

"scripts": {
  "convert:talo": "ts-node node_modules/talo-converter-openapi3-swagger2/bin/talo-converter-openapi3-swagger2  --from=openapi_3 --to=swagger_2 'openapi/_build/openapi.yaml' > openapi/_build/swagger.json"
}

Luego, ejecute el siguiente comando:

npm run convert:talo

Este comando convertirá el archivo openapi.yaml ubicado en openapi/_build a un archivo swagger.json en el directorio que indica luego del >.

Nota

1) Asegúrese de tener ts-node instalado 2) Los parámetros son obligatorios --from=openapi_3 y --to=swagger_2 3) Asegúrese de encerrar la ruta donde está ubicado el archivo openapi.yaml entre comillas simples la ruta donde esta ubicado el archivo openapi.yaml de primer lugar seguido de el simbolo > seguido de la ruta donde desea que sea generado el nuevo archivo ya convertido a swagger2